Output 23665eceb0fbfc63ee3a30204b0a0c074f9cfe3d58184439f9d032bda924b47a:0

value
998726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3648cd20cf671a2d20b5488d8e5d4d24e444fd OP_EQUAL
address
3P8hkNLiue7qNaqp24ta1d6MD2Y8WX5wvz
transaction
23665eceb0fbfc63ee3a30204b0a0c074f9cfe3d58184439f9d032bda924b47a
spent
true